Savac [サヴアク (Savaku)] is the evil deity released by Dio Sivac in BakuTech! Bakugan.

Anime[edit]

BakuTech! Bakugan (Anime)[edit]

In the sixteenth episode, Zakuro uses Savac to strike fear and enter the hearts of both Harubaru and Raichi. Later on, Savac is seen standing in the right direction after Koh Grif's Kilan Leoness was overpowered and knocked out of the Gate Card. Zakuro also used Savac during his brawl against Harubaru to curse the latter's Rise Dragaon.

Physical Game[edit]

Savac is the small die cast projectile piece that came with BTC-13 Dio Sivac. It's commonly seen in silver although a Gold and Copper Version was released as Limited Editions to an event or campaign.

It has a 200 Gs Power Boost printed on its back. In the official BakuTech game Rules, if you rolled Dio Sivac and Savac stands right-side-up, you may add that 200 Gs Power Boost to Dio Sivac.

Etymology[edit]

Savac is from the Japanese adverb meaning "To Judge" 裁く (sabaku?).
